In 1898 John James Coulton who was the Lord of the Manor tried to auction part of his Estate in Higher Sea Lane. The plans show that he had split the field into 55 lots. unfortunatley very few were sold. He tried again in 1904 to sell the remainder, but this time no one turned up to bid. It was not until 1910 after he had died that the wealthy owner of the neighbouring Wootton Fitzpaine, Alfred Pass bought the balance and was the Lord of the Manor until his death in 1970.
